The NM_001113378.2(FANCI):c.1420C>A(p.Leu474Ile) variant causes a missense change. The variant allele was found at a frequency of 0.00000124 in 1,613,666 control chromosomes in the GnomAD database, with no homozygous occurrence. Variant has been reported in ClinVar as Uncertain significance (★★).

FANCI (HGNC:25568): (FA complementation group I) The Fanconi anemia complementation group (FANC) currently includes FANCA, FANCB, FANCC, FANCD1 (also called BRCA2), FANCD2, FANCE, FANCF, FANCG, FANCI, FANCJ (also called BRIP1), FANCL, FANCM and FANCN (also called PALB2). The previously defined group FANCH is the same as FANCA. Fanconi anemia is a genetically heterogeneous recessive disorder characterized by cytogenetic instability, hypersensitivity to DNA crosslinking agents, increased chromosomal breakage, and defective DNA repair. The members of the Fanconi anemia complementation group do not share sequence similarity; they are related by their assembly into a common nuclear protein complex. This gene encodes the protein for complementation group I. Alternative splicing results in two transcript variants encoding different isoforms. [provided by RefSeq, Jul 2008]

Uncertain significance, criteria provided, single submitter | clinical testing | Invitae | Feb 24, 2023 | This sequence change replaces leucine, which is neutral and non-polar, with isoleucine, which is neutral and non-polar, at codon 474 of the FANCI protein (p.Leu474Ile). This variant is present in population databases (rs746777753, gnomAD 0.003%). This variant has not been reported in the literature in individuals affected with FANCI-related conditions. ClinVar contains an entry for this variant (Variation ID: 526395). Advanced modeling of protein sequence and biophysical properties (such as structural, functional, and spatial information, amino acid conservation, physicochemical variation, residue mobility, and thermodynamic stability) has been performed at Invitae for this missense variant, however the output from this modeling did not meet the statistical confidence thresholds required to predict the impact of this variant on FANCI protein function. In summary, the available evidence is currently insufficient to determine the role of this variant in disease. Therefore, it has been classified as a Variant of Uncertain Significance. - |
